#body .pagecontainer {
	width: 100%;
	max-width: 1100px;
	margin: 0 auto;
	position: relative;
}

#gh {
	z-index: 10;
	margin-bottom: 35px;
}


/*DISATTIVA INTESTAZIONI EBAY*/

.gh-tbl {
	display: none;
}

.v4bc {
	display: none;
}

td.gh-td {
	display: none;
}

td#gh-title {
	display: none;
}


/*div#gh-top,#gh-gb {
	width: 1100px;
	margin: 0 auto;
	display: block;
}*/


/*DISATTIVA SPAZIO TRA HEADER E BODY*/

td[height="15"] {
	display: none;
}

table.tb_v4bc {
	margin-bottom: -45px;
}


/*Link ebay per salvare il venditore*/

.v4sem {
	position: relative;
	top: 235px;
	right: 780px;
	color: #1b1b1b;
	font-weight: 300 !important;
	z-index: 1;
	width: 320px !important;
	display: none;
}

.v4sem a {
	color: #1b1b1b !important;
	text-decoration: none !important;
	font-weight: 300;
}


/*FOOTER IMPOSTAZIONI*/

.stBadge {
	display: none;
}

footer#glbfooter {
	display: none;
}


/*IMPOSTAZIONI BARRA LATERALE*/

#LeftPanel {
	color: white !important;
}

#LeftPanel+td {
	display: none;
}

#LeftPanel .v4midBox a,
#LeftPanel .v4midBox a:active,
#LeftPanel .v4midBox a:visited,
#LeftPanel .v4midBox a:hover {
	color: white !important;
	text-decoration: none;
}

#LeftPanel td.v4mid {
	background: #141414;
}

#LeftPanel td.v4mid * {
	color: white;
}

table.v4midBox {
	border: 0;
	background-color: #e2e2e2;
}

#LeftPanel .ttl {
	color: white;
}

#LeftPanel .v4title {
	padding: 10px 15px;
}

#LeftPanel .v4title h2 {
	font-size: 18px;
}

#LeftPanel .cnt {
	color: #a0a0a0;
	font-weight: 300;
}

#LeftPanel form[name="Search"] tr:first-of-type {
	padding-bottom: 10px;
	display: block;
}

#LeftPanel form[name="Search"] input[type="submit"] {
	background: url('../img/icons/icon-find.png');
	background-position: center;
	background-size: 100%;
	background-size: contain;
	background-repeat: no-repeat;
	border: 0;
	color: transparent;
	width: 25px;
	height: 25px;
	margin-left: 10px;
	display: block;
}

#LeftPanel form[name="Search"] input[type="text"] {
	background: #202020;
	color: white;
	padding: 5px;
	width: 140px;
	border-radius: 5px;
	border: 0;
	font-weight: 300 !important;
	font-family: 'Source Sans Pro', sans-serif !important;
}

#LeftPanel input[type="checkbox"] {
	margin-right: 5px !important;
}

#LeftPanel form input[type="submit"] {
	color: #202020;
	padding: 5px 15px;
	width: auto;
	border-radius: 0;
	font-size: 14px;
	font-weight: 400;
	cursor: pointer;
}


/*IMPOSTAZIONI PROMO E BLOCCHI MODULI*/

#TopPromoArea {}

td.v4accent,
td.v4hspacer {
	background: #222222 !important;
	display: none;
}

td.v4title {
	background: #0b8de1 !important;
}

td.v4title h2,
td.v4title font {
	color: #white !important;
	font-size: 15px !important;
	position: relative;
}

td.v4title h2:after {
	content: "";
	border-right: 0.8em solid white;
	border-top: 0.8em solid transparent;
	position: absolute;
	top: 0;
	right: 0;
	-webkit-transform: rotateZ(45deg);
	-ms-transform: rotateZ(45deg);
	-o-transform: rotateZ(45deg);
	transform: rotateZ(45deg);
}

td.v4baccent {
	background: #0b8de1;
}

#TopPromoArea td.v4vspacer,
#TopPromoArea td.v4baccent {
	display: none;
}

#TopPromoArea td.v4title {
	background: none !important;
	text-align: center;
	padding: 10px 0;
}

#TopPromoArea td.v4title h2,
#TopPromoArea td.v4title font {
	color: #575757 !important;
	font-size: 24px !important;
	position: relative;
}

#TopPromoArea .ttl.g-std a {
	color: inherit;
	font-weight: 400 !important;
}

#TopPromoArea tr.v4footr td.v4footd {
	background: none;
	border: none;
	font-family: 'Source Sans Pro', serif;
	font-size: 16px;
}

#TopPromoArea tr.v4footr td.v4footd a,
#TopPromoArea tr.v4footr td.v4footd a:visited {
	text-decoration: none;
	color: inherit !important;
	font-size: 15px;
	font-weight: 300;
}


/*STYLE EBAY PRODOTTI*/


/*impostare sfondo al blocco prodotti*/

.tb_v4bc+table table[border="0"]+table {
	background: #f5f5f5;
}


/*disattivazione elementi non necessari parte alta*/

.v4stabl {
	display: none;
}

.r3_t,
.r3_t b,
.r3_bl,
.r3_bl b {
	display: none;
}

.r3_hm,
.r3_c,
.r3_s {
	border: none;
}

.smuy {
	font-family: 'Source Sans Pro', sans-serif !important;
	background: #0b8de1;
	display:block;
	padding: 10px 15px;
	width: 50%;
	position: relative;
	float: left;
	right: 20px;
	text-align: right;
}

.smuy span {
	color: white !important;
	background: none !important;
}

.ctrlbr {
	text-align: center;
	border: none;
	padding: 10px 15px;
}

.ctrlbr span.pdmt .label {
	font-weight: bold;
}

.ctrlbr span.pdmt .cur {
	color: #191919;
}

.ctrlbr .label,
.ctrlbr .cur {
	font-size: 20px;
	font-family: 'Source Sans Pro', sans-serif;
	font-weight: 300;
	color: #191919;
}

.cmpBr {
	display: none;
}

.rs_box {
	border: none;
	/*padding-top: 30px;*/
}

.itemseparator {
	display: none;
}


/*fine disattivazioni*/



#CentralArea td.gallery.left {
	border: 0;
}


/*impostazioni colore e testo*/

#CentralArea .gallery,
#CentralArea .gallery a,
#CentralArea .gallery a:active {
	color: #1b1b1b !important;
	font-family: 'Source Sans Pro', sans-serif;
	text-decoration: none !important;
	text-align: center;
}

#CentralArea td.gallery {
	padding: 5px 20px;
}

#CentralArea table.gallery {
	border-bottom: 2px solid transparent;
	cursor: pointer;
	display: block;
	min-height: 450px;
	padding: 5px;
	-webkit-transition: border-bottom 0.4s ease;
	-o-transition: border-bottom 0.4s ease;
	transition: border-bottom 0.4s ease;
}

#CentralArea table.gallery:hover {
	border-bottom: 2px solid #202020;
}

#CentralArea table.gallery>tbody>tr:last-of-type {
	padding: 20px;
	display: block;
	position: relative;
	box-sizing: border-box;
}

table.fixed {
	width: 100%;
}

table.fixed>tbody>tr:first-of-type>td {
	text-align: center;
	font-size: 1em !important;
	font-family: 'Source Sans Pro', sans-serif;
	display: block;
}

table.gallery table.fixed span.disct,
table.gallery table.prices span.disct,
span.fshp {
	color: #141414;
}

span.bin.g-b {
	width: 100%;
	text-align: center;
	display: block;
	margin: 0 auto;
	font-family: 'Source Sans Pro', sans-serif;
	font-size: 18px;
	font-weight: 600;
}

.ttl.g-std a {
	font-family: 'Source Sans Pro', sans-serif;
	font-size: 15px;
	font-weight: 300;
}

span.label {
	color: #1b1b1b;
}


/*pagination*/

#CentralArea .dynpg {
	border: none !important;
}

table.pgbc {
	border: none;
	background: #3caad7;
	color: white;
}

table.pgbc a,
table.pgbc a:active {
	color: inherit;
	text-decoration: none !important;
}

.prev a:first-of-type {
	display: none;
}

.next a:last-of-type {
	display: none;
}

td.pages {
	color: inherit;
}

td.pages .pipe {
	color: inherit;
}

.form input.page {
	border-radius: 2px;
	box-shadow: 0 0 0 !important;
	border: 0;
	padding: 10px;
	box-sizing: content-box;
	color: #1b1b1b;
	width: 50px;
}

input[type="submit"] {
	width: 50px;
	padding: 10px;
	border: 1px solid #f0f0f0;
	border-radius: 4px;
	color: #1b1b1b;
	background: white;
}
